// SEAT_GRID_CELL_PX controls the base cell size for the Proscenia
// seat-map renderer. Yes, it's a magic number — the Gildhall balcony
// layout breaks below 14px and looks comically huge above 22.
// If you change it, eyeball the Orpheum Rose mock venue first;
// its wraparound boxes are the worst case. Flagging for the sync:
// last verified against the build whose token is below.

session token of fafof-bahof = htk9_cde2d95fb

## Deployment

Giftleaf's receipt mailer runs as a single worker pool behind the Parchwell queue. Plugin authors should note that hooks execute inside the same process as template rendering, so any blocking call in your plugin delays the whole batch. Deploy your plugin bundle to the shared extensions directory, then restart the worker pool; hot reload is deliberately disabled to keep receipt numbering consistent. Before writing any hook, review the runtime settings your code will inherit, which are reproduced in full below.

service settings:
HOLIX_HOST=holix.qorvelsys.internal
HOLIX_PORT=7000

AUDIT ITEM 14: Legacy ORM refactor — Tallowgrid

Verify the old Hobnail ORM layer is fully removed from billing paths. Check: no raw mapper calls remain, repository pattern adopted in all three modules, integration tests pass against the Cindervault schema, and the deprecated session pool is deleted. New team members should flag any Hobnail import they find. Findings and exceptions must be reported to the owner named below.

approver of tawif-kafog = Lamdor Brivan

Team,

The overhaul of the Lumenperks programme at Castavel Retail is moving into the design-freeze stage. Key changes: consolidated tiers, simplified earn rates, and a shortened redemption window. Finance has validated the liability model; operations will confirm system readiness by the end of the month. Please review the attached impact summary for your departments and send questions before Thursday's sync. The confidential note on forward business plans is included directly below.

Regards,
Mirelle

management briefing: Oliaxox Foods is in early talks to buy Quenokox Systems for about $413.6 million. The Gorys launch date is February 25, and nothing goes to the press before then. Legal wants the Holionix Logistics term sheet redrafted before January 27.